Kim Parrish – Accounting for Income Tax Specialist

Kim is a CPA with over 25-years experience in corporate and partnership tax in both public and private companies across industries. She brings a continuous improvement focus to her role in increasing tax efficiencies and identifying strategic planning opportunities. Her tax specialties include:
- Income tax accounting (ASC 740/FAS 109), including preparation, review and consulting
- Sarbanes Oxley governance, focusing on minimizing financial restatement risk
- Building and managing effective and resource-efficient tax functions
- Tax controversy defense
- Modeling to improve tax planning
- Tax transaction (M&A) work and due diligence
In recent years, Kim has focused her work on small and mid-size businesses, helping them to understand their tax obligations and filing requirements and the impact of policy changes to reduce risk. Her work building and reviewing financial models supports cost control, profit realization, and budgetary requirements as well as provides data and analytics that inform stakeholders of the impact of tax on business strategy.
In addition to her work with PricewaterhouseCoopers and EY, Kim helped establish a tax department and manage tax controversy work for Cloud Peak Energy during the NYSE-traded company’s IPO and secondary offering in its first year of operations. She also held several positions with Newmont Mining Corporation, both in the US and with Newmont Asia Pacific, where she was instrumental in establishing an effective tax accounting function, managing external relationships with auditors, and creating a control structure around Sarbanes Oxley requirements.
Kim received her Master of Taxation from the University of Denver and a BS in finance from the University of Colorado in Boulder.
